It's rare for a coach to start his head coaching career at a place, have success, leave for another opportunity, then return 13 years later to the place where it all started.
Sean Miller is returning to Xavier University as the men's basketball head coach, The Enquirer confirmed on Saturday evening. The news was first reported by Pete Thamel and Jeff Borzello.
Miller was an assistant coach at Xavier from 2001-04. He was the Musketeers' head coach from 2004-09, taking Xavier to four NCAA Tournaments, an Elite Eight and a Sweet Sixteen.
Then he left for Arizona, where he continued to rack up quality results with seven NCAA Tournament appearances, including three Elite Eights, two Sweet Sixteens and five Pac-12 Conference championships.
